			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div>The new book I just bought at my local Barnes and Noble to fight off NFL boredom today. But the book now out in hardback only is about an epic tale 0f Chinatown underworld and the American Dream.<br />
In the 80's a wave of Chinese from the Fujian province began arriving in America with an intense work ethic and belief in the promise of America. Many of them lived in a world outside the law working in a shadow economy overseen by the ruthless gangs that ruled NY's Chinatown...<br />
But the figure who came to dominate this Chinese underworld was a middle-aged grannie known as Sister Ping!<br />
She owns a tiny noodle shop on Hester street and from her shop she made $40 million bucks smuggling ppl into the country. That is what a &quot;Snake Head&quot; does. <br />
As a snake head Sister Ping built a global conglomerate and employed one of Chinatowns most violent gangs to protect her power and profits....<br />
An underworld CEO she is...LOL...<br />
 <br />
In Chinatown she is revered as a home grown &quot;Don Corleone&quot;/<br />
 <br />
And &quot;The LAW&quot; could never quite catch her....<br />
It took the famous &quot;Jade Squad&quot; and the FBI 10 years to bring this lady down. An intimate tour on the mean streets of Chinatown and organized crime in an age of globalizations. <br />
